#c5bd10 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c5bd10 is composed of 77.3% red, 74.1%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 4.1% magenta, 91.9%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 57.3 degrees, a saturation of 85% and a lightness of 41.8%. #c5bd10 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ff20 with #8b7b00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c00.

Shades and Tints of #c5bd10

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100f01 is the darkest color, while #fffffc is the lightest one.
